    Abstract: A tread portion 2 of a tire 1 includes a plurality of shoulder blocks 11 and a plurality of middle blocks 12. An inner edge 11B in the tire axial direction of a tread surface of each shoulder block 11 protrudes on an outer side in a tire radial direction with respect to a virtual profile 18. A side surface S on the inner side in the tire axial direction of each shoulder block 11 includes one first side surface S1 extending from the inner edge 11B toward a groove bottom, and at least one second side surface S2 extending from a bottom side end of the first side surface S1 toward the groove bottom, and the second side surface S2 is a surface inclined toward the inner side in the tire axial direction relative to the first side surface S1.

    Abstract: A motorcycle tire comprises a carcass having a bias structure, a band comprising a jointiess ply, and a tread rubber disposed on the radially outside of the band. The loss tangent of the tread rubber at a temperature of 0 deg C. is larger in a tread crown region than in tread shoulder regions. The carcass comprises an outer carcass ply of carcass cords. The angles of the carcass cords with respect to the tire circumferential direction are smaller in the tread crown region than in the tread shoulder regions.

    Abstract: A motorcycle tire is provided in the tread portion with first inclined main grooves and second inclined main grooves which are arranged alternately in the tire circumferential direction while inclining in opposite directions. The first inclined main grooves extend from a first tread edge toward a second tread edge across the tire equator and terminate at the respective second inclined main grooves which extend from the second tread edge toward the first tread edge across the tire equator and terminate at the respective first inclined main grooves which are respectively next to the above-said first inclined main grooves. A first region, which is delimited by the first tread edge, two of the first inclined main grooves and one of the second inclined main grooves, is provided with blocks whose ground contacting top surfaces have vertices each having an angle of not less than 45 degrees.

    Abstract: A motorcycle tire is provided with a tread pattern made up of circumferentially alternately arranged first and second pattern units. The first pattern unit is substantially mirror symmetrical with the second pattern unit. Each pattern unit comprises a main oblique groove and first and second auxiliary oblique grooves, each of which is a bent groove having a bent position and composed of a steeply-inclined part and a mildly-inclined part, in the main oblique groove, the steeply-inclined part extends from a start position on one side of the tire equator to the bent position on the other side of the tire equator, while inclining to one tire circumferential direction; and the mildly-inclined part extends from the bent position to the adjacent tread edge, while inclining to the above-mentioned one tire circumferential direction.
